A transformer circuit is defined as a minimal set of model components that is both sufficient for the task and minimal (no proper subset reproduces the behavior), not merely correlated with it
Summary
When we say we've found the circuit responsible for a behavior in a transformer, we mean those specific components are both enough on their own to produce the behavior and that no smaller group within them could do the same job. This matters because it sets a real causal bar: it's not enough to notice that certain parts light up during a task, we have to show they are the actual mechanism with no redundant or merely alongside components sneaking in.
